如何在Ubuntu 11.10和Ubuntu 12.04 LTS上安装Clojure 1.5

时间:2013-06-03 04:55:30

标签: ubuntu clojure

我是一名初学者。

我尝试在Ubuntu 11.10和Ubuntu 12.04 LTS上搜索clojure 1.5安装方法

但我没找到。

如果有人知道,请回答我,

如果有分步安装步骤或照片,最好

谢谢。

2 个答案:

答案 0 :(得分:6)

Clojure不是一个独立的程序;相反,它像一个库一样使用,作为依赖项添加到每个Clojure项目中。因此,您不需要安装Clojure,而是安装能够管理依赖关系的构建工具。

Clojure社区中最受欢迎的此类构建工具是Leiningen;请点击链接获取安装说明。 (Leiningen有一个Debian软件包,您可以使用aptitude / apt-get进行安装,但此时它已经过时了。很高兴,手动安装只需要一个命令。)一旦获得它安装后,在终端中执行以下操作:

$ lein new app hello-world
$ cd hello-world
$ lein run
Hello, World!

最后一行是您应该在当前版本的应用模板中看到的内容。查看hello-world目录可以了解基本Clojure项目的结构。此外,Leiningen的文档非常好,你绝对应该至少浏览它。

除了Leiningen之外,任何Java开发人员都会熟悉MavenGradle - clojuresque的Clojure插件。

所有这些都共享Maven基础架构,因此无论您选择哪一个,您都可以访问整个Clojure(和Java)库的生态系统。

答案 1 :(得分:0)

对于完整的设置,包括功能性emacs,leiningen和ubuntu,所有设置都在方便的Vagrant设置中,请参阅: Vagrant / Clojure / Emacs